The International Electrotechnical Commission (IEC) is a worldwide non-profit organization that creates and publishes standards for electrical, electronic, and related technologies. Founded on June 26, 1906, in London, it plays a crucial role in ensuring that products and systems are safe, efficient, reliable, and interoperable. Today, the IEC’s headquarters are located in Geneva, Switzerland.
